ZIP code 42035 is a sparsely populated 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Cunningham, Carlisle County, Kentucky, home to just 1,068 residents across 72.7 square miles, a density of 15 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.
ZIP 42035 reports a modest median household income of $55,515 (7% below the average Kentucky ZIP), while per-capita income is $29,638. The poverty rate is 12.5%, with unemployment at 2.5%; those measures add context to the income figure. The ACS does not report a median home value for this ZIP, so housing cost context is limited to the available tenure and rent fields.
Educational attainment sits below the national norm: 16.1%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 37.1, and the average commute is -. Census Bureau data shows 25 business establishments in ZIP 42035, employing approximately 130 people with a combined annual payroll of $6,249,000.

What county is ZIP code 42035 in?
ZIP code 42035 (Cunningham) is located in Carlisle County, Kentucky. Carlisle County contains multiple ZIP codes, see the full list at /counties/carlisle-ky.
What is the population of ZIP code 42035?
ZIP code 42035 in Cunningham, KY has a population of 1,068 according to the Census Bureau ACS 2023 estimates.
What is the median household income in ZIP 42035?
The median household income in ZIP 42035 is $55,515, which is 27% below the national average of $76,288.
What is the demographic makeup of ZIP 42035?
The largest racial group in ZIP 42035 is White at 92.0%. Hispanic or Latino residents make up 9.2% of the population.
How many businesses are in ZIP code 42035?
ZIP code 42035 has 25 business establishments employing approximately 130 people, according to Census Bureau ZIP Code Business Patterns (ZBP) 2023 data.
What is the education level in ZIP code 42035?
In ZIP code 42035, 61.0% of residents aged 25+ have a high school diploma or higher, and 16.1% hold a bachelor's degree or higher. These figures come from the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ates (2023).
What percentage of residents own vs. rent in ZIP 42035?
In ZIP code 42035, approximately 91.4%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ied and 8.6% are renter-occupied, based on Census ACS 2023 data.
What is the poverty rate in ZIP code 42035?
The poverty rate in ZIP code 42035 is 12.5% according to Census Bureau ACS 2023 estimates. This measures the percentage of the population living below the federal poverty threshold.
